Understanding Serendipity: Beyond Randomness
Serendipity, in the context of environments and gameplay, refers to unexpected yet beneficial discoveries that occur when individuals encounter elements or opportunities they did not anticipate. Unlike pure randomness, which is entirely unpredictable, serendipity often emerges from the interplay of open systems, flexible rules, and human curiosity.
For example, in urban exploration, a visitor might stumble upon a hidden courtyard or local art installation that was not part of the original plan but enriches their experience profoundly. Similarly, in game design, players may encounter unexpected strategic options or narrative branches that deepen engagement, often leading to memorable moments that weren’t explicitly scripted.
These discoveries are not merely accidents; they are the result of environments that allow for exploration and unintended interactions, highlighting serendipity’s nuanced distinction from mere chance or rigid design.
Serendipity as a Catalyst for Innovation in Design
Throughout history, serendipitous moments have sparked revolutionary ideas in architecture, urban planning, and game development. For instance, the discovery of Velcro was a serendipitous outcome of a Swiss engineer’s observations of plant burrs sticking to his clothing, leading to a new fastening technology that found diverse applications.
In urban design, the unexpected convergence of pedestrian pathways or natural features often inspires creative interventions, such as the transformation of underused spaces into vibrant community hubs. Likewise, in game design, unforeseen player interactions can lead developers to evolve mechanics and narratives, creating emergent gameplay that surpasses initial intentions.
Case studies like the development of Minecraft illustrate how unplanned player collaborations and discoveries have driven the game’s evolution, emphasizing serendipity’s role as a catalyst for innovation rather than mere coincidence.
The Mechanisms Facilitating Serendipitous Discoveries
Designing for openness and adaptability is crucial for fostering serendipity. Flexible environments—such as modular urban layouts or sandbox game worlds—allow users to explore beyond predefined paths, increasing the likelihood of unexpected encounters.
Incorporating randomness and unpredictability, through techniques like procedural generation or stochastic algorithms, further amplifies serendipitous moments. For example, adaptive algorithms in recommendation systems introduce serendipity by suggesting unexpected yet relevant content, enriching user experience.
Tools such as participatory design platforms enable stakeholders to contribute unpredictably, leading to solutions that are both innovative and rooted in diverse human inputs. Technologies like virtual reality and AI-driven environments are increasingly used to craft spaces where chance interactions flourish.

Challenges in Harnessing Serendipity Without Compromising Intentional Design
While fostering serendipity offers numerous benefits, it also presents challenges. Maintaining a balance between control and spontaneity is critical; overly rigid environments suppress unexpected interactions, whereas excessive randomness can lead to chaos or undesired outcomes.
Over-reliance on serendipitous outcomes might undermine strategic goals or coherence in design. Therefore, integrating serendipity requires thoughtful frameworks that allow for flexibility while preserving core objectives.
Strategies include iterative testing, user-centered participatory design, and adaptive systems that respond to unpredictable inputs without losing sight of overarching aims.
